The thing you are missing is this, you don't have to steal the members from the other forum, you can advertise your forum on other sites, like the sites of the manufacturers of the bikes.

You can buy banners on the magazines websites that cater to the industry also, there are also trade shows and race organizer sites you can buy banners on.

Think of the sites your target member goes to all the time, run a survey on your forum and find out what sites your members go to and buy ads on those sites.

If you don't want to go through all of the above just buy ADWORDS and the ads will hit all the motorcycle sites out there.
